Impact on productivity

A strike in business can have profound effects on multiple dimensions of an organization, encompassing its operations, finances, and overall reputation. Firstly, strikes can disrupt normal business operations and lead to a significant decrease in productivity. When employees go on strike, key services and functions may be disrupted, resulting in delays in production, distribution, and customer service. The absence of skilled workers can hinder the organization's ability to meet customer demands and fulfill orders, thereby causing a decline in revenue and potential damage to business relationships.

Company's reputation

Secondly, strikes can have detrimental consequences for a company's reputation. Strikes often attract media attention and public scrutiny, potentially casting a negative light on the organization. Negative publicity surrounding a strike can erode consumer trust and loyalty, leading to decreased sales and a loss of market share. The company may be perceived as an unfavorable employer, which can make it challenging to attract and retain top talent in the future. Additionally, a tarnished reputation resulting from a strike can have long-term implications, affecting partnerships, contracts, and even the ability to secure new business opportunities.

Financial burdens

Lastly, strikes can impose significant financial burdens on businesses. Employers may incur additional costs during strikes, such as hiring temporary workers or implementing contingency plans to maintain minimal operations. The loss of revenue, combined with increased expenses, can strain a company's financial resources and overall profitability. Furthermore, prolonged strikes may lead to a loss of investor confidence, resulting in a decline in stock prices and potential difficulties in accessing capital for future growth and investment. The financial repercussions can extend beyond the duration of the strike itself, affecting the organization's ability to recover and compete effectively in the marketplace.
